It also reduces the amount of noise

You might be curious about how noise-reducing windows can enhance the comfort of your home. In fact there are many factors that contribute to the reduction of noise.

The first thing to consider is the thickness of the glass used in the unit may impact the transmission of sound. The noise reduction is higher when the glass is thicker. If a window is made of different thicknesses of glass the frequency of resonance of the sound wave will alter.

Another factor that affects transmission of sound is the frame. Windows with frames made of light weight materials will allow less noise to flow through. However, heavier materials may also decrease the frequency of resonance. For instance, a timber frame will stop virtually all sound, while an uPVC frame will reduce the vibrations.

Based on the outside noise level, you may need to consider a window with an insulated glass. These windows are known as laminated acoustic glasses. This technology works by putting an extra layer of insulation on top of the standard acoustic window. It is able to reduce noise further, especially in higher frequencies.

You can further improve the sound reduction of your new window by installing a high-efficiency cellular spacer. These spacers are designed to reduce air leaks and reduce sound. The seals must be of the highest quality.

A properly fitted window can make a huge difference in the reduction of noise. A standard Everest doubleor triple-glazed window can reduce noise levels up to 25 percent.

The soundproofing of your window could be an permanent solution to your noise issue. You can also add insulation or laminate to your windows in addition double glazing.

It slows down the transfer of heat energy.

Double-glazed windows are designed to limit the loss of heat through glass, thus reducing the cost of energy and keeping your home warmer during winter and cooler during summer. A double-glazed window comprises two panes, each with Argon gas in between. It's also designed to minimize outside noise.

Double-glazed windows are designed to keep heat out and condensation. Condensation occurs when warm air from the outside meets the colder inner glass. This means less heat is transferred to your home, reducing cost of energy and helping the environment.

Double-glazed windows should have the highest thermal performance to maximize their potential. A higher energy efficiency rating will reflect real-world performance. The U-value is a measurement of heat transfer through the glass. However, the real value is the quality of manufacturing and how well your windows seal.

Double-glazed windows can be enhanced by a range of methods. To stop condensation the use of an insulated vacuum gas is also used.

Double-glazed windows can be improved in energy efficiency by filling the space between them argon gas. Argon is an inert, non-toxic gas that conducts heat slowly. Because it is slow, it is efficient in slowing the transfer of heat from the inner to the glass replacement window's outer pane.

Double-glazed windows can be improved by adding Argon gas to their thermal performance. This can increase the window's thermal performance by up to 30%. Argon is a very efficient conductor of heat but it's also slow. Argon can decrease the transfer of heat between the inner glass and outer glass by up to 34%.
